Will try this. > >At 02:13 PM 6/9/2003 -0400, Tony Schreiber wrote: > >Pretty much the same as Windows. > > > >1) STOP the cf service(s). > >2) Edit the registry file (/opt/coldfusion/registry/cf.registry by > >default), look for UseAdminPassword, change it to 0. Save. > >3) Fire cf back up and login to admin, set a new password. > > > > > I have a remote system that I am administering where I have lost the CF > > > Admin password. I have root access to the box. Anyone know how to > reset the > > > CF Administrator password?
